Based in the heart of the English Lake District, brewers of bold, innovative beers since 2002, our beer range is eclectic and includes thirst quenching session beers, big hopped pale ales, deep dark stouts and sours. With a range of core beers, available in Cask, Keg, Bottle and Can.
At Hawkshead Brewery we make the sort of beer we like to drink - distinctive, full of flavour, handmade, and perfectly crafted. We are small enough to know most of our customers, not to care about the mass market, be able to brew lots of different beers, experiment and innovate. We are big enough to employ a team of five brewers, make around 140 barrels (23,000 litres) of beer a week, deliver direct throughout The North, and our Tap at our Staveley site is open every day.
In about 2017, a controlling interest in the company was taken by Liverpool-based Halewood Wines & Spirits, and this may result in further expansion.

25/3/2023. Bottle from CentrAle, Newcastle. Shared at SBGP1. Pours black with a frothy tan coloured head. Beautiful pour. Aroma of dark chocolate, molasses, roasted malt, nut, cocoa, light coffee, liquorice and treacle. Moderate sweetness, medium bitterness. Medium to full bodied, smooth and creamy, soft carbonation. Very good.

23/3/2023. Can from LowCostBeer.com. Pours clear bright amber gold with a small frothy white head. Aroma is dank, hoppy, resin, toffee, biscuit, citrus fruits. Moderate sweetness, quite heavy bitterness. Medium body, very oily, average carbonation. Bitter, piney finish. Bit old school, but enjoyable.
